Agrochemicals are essential to modern agriculture, but handling them safely requires careful coordination across every stage of the product lifecycle. From manufacturing and packaging to transport and application, each step introduces potential risks. When spills occur, the impact often extends beyond immediate cleanup, affecting operations, compliance, and environmental responsibility. Reducing these risks starts with a proactive, system-wide approach to safety.
Addressing Risk Before It Escalates
Not all spill risks are obvious. Small leaks or repeated minor releases can accumulate over time, leading to equipment degradation, contaminated surfaces, and unsafe working conditions. These issues may develop gradually, making them easy to overlook until they begin to affect productivity or require costly intervention. Preventative measures that identify and address vulnerabilities early help limit these long-term impacts.
Maintaining Control Across Complex Supply Chains
Agrochemicals often move through multiple facilities and partners before reaching their end use. Each transfer point introduces variability, from differences in equipment to inconsistent handling practices. Establishing clear standards and ensuring compatibility across systems helps maintain control throughout the process. Reliable packaging and consistent filling operations also reduce the likelihood of errors during these transitions.
The Role of Packaging and Equipment Design
Packaging plays a direct role in spill prevention. Containers that are difficult to handle or not suited for automated processes can increase the risk of tipping, dropping, or improper connections. Well-designed packaging, on the other hand, supports stability, ease of use, and compatibility with handling systems. When paired with precise filling equipment, it reduces manual handling and helps maintain consistency across operations.
Supporting Safety Through Training and Communication
Even the most effective systems depend on the people using them. Proper training ensures that employees understand how to operate equipment safely and recognize early signs of potential issues. Clear labeling, accessible documentation, and ongoing communication help reinforce best practices, especially during transport and storage.
Preparing for Unexpected Events
While prevention is critical, preparedness is equally important. Having established response procedures allows teams to act quickly when incidents occur, minimizing disruption and reducing potential harm. Integrating these plans into daily operations and reinforcing them through regular reviews helps ensure they remain effective.
A Continuous Approach to Spill Prevention
Spill prevention is not a one-time effort. It requires ongoing attention to design, process, and training. Organizations that treat it as a continuous process are better positioned to maintain safe operations, protect their workforce, and support long-term environmental stewardship.
